Most Wins by Manufacturer: Toyota, 3; Ford, 1; Dodge, 1Races won from starting pos 1: 2 [1 was set by owners pts, inclement weather]
Races won from starting pos 8: 1
Races won from starting pos 9: 1 [set by rules book, practice speeds, inclement weather]
Races won from starting pos 16: 1
Races won from the top 5: 2 of 5
Races won from the top 10: 4 of 5
Races won from starting pos 8: 1
Races won from starting pos 9: 1 [set by rules book, practice speeds, inclement weather]
Races won from starting pos 16: 1
Races won from the top 5: 2 of 5
Races won from the top 10: 4 of 5